After a long wait, the 499P has arrived, the new Le Mans Hypercar with which Ferrari will face the FIA ​​WEC endurance world championship in the premier class starting from 2023, and it is a name that evokes the history of the Prancing Horse.

In the livery design with which the 499P will debut in the next 1000 Miglia di Sebring (USA), the famous color scheme already introduced in the 312 P of the seventies has been taken up, which also visually underlines the connection with a story interrupted 50 years ago, but always present in the essence of the brand.

For this reason, number 50 will be one of the two with which the cars from Maranello will be entered in the world championship, while the other will be number 51, one of the most successful ever.


    The 499P, which was officially presented to the press during the Ferrari Finali Mondiali taking place at the Imola racetrack, is a hybrid car with a twin-turbo V6 engine derived from the Ferrari 296 combined with an electric motor that develops a total of 680 hp.

"It is a dream that becomes reality - said Antonello Coletta, Head of Ferrari Sport Activities GT -.


    We wanted to pay homage to our history, with many small and big references to a past made up of successes and titles. In doing so, however, we have looked ahead, creating a manifesto of our commitment to world endurance. A project that starts from afar and is now taking shape. It will be a test bed for developing cutting-edge technological solutions to be adopted on the road cars produced in Maranello ".


    All the corporate realities were involved in the definition of the 499P, drawing on the universe of technical, professional and human excellence that characterize the Maranello company.

Overall, more than 100 people worked on the project under the careful technical direction of Ferdinando Cannizzo, head of the GT and Sport racing car development body.


    "The hybrid powertrain of the 499P - explained Cannizzo - combines a heat engine, located in a central-rear position, with an electric motor, on the front axle.


    The ICE unit - Internal Combustion Engine - has a maximum power on the ground, limited by the regulation, of 500 kW (680 hp) and is derived from the V6 biturbo road family.


    The internal combustion engine, which shares the architecture of the engine mounted on the 296 GT3, compared to the latter has undergone a profound review by the Maranello technicians, aimed both at developing ad hoc solutions for the prototype and at the overall lightening.

Among the specific characteristics of the "V" six-cylinder of the 499P - he added - the fact that the drive unit is of the load-bearing type and therefore performs a valuable structural function, compared to the versions fitted to the racing touring cars, where the engine is mounted on the chassis of the car ". The second" soul "of the hybrid powerplant is represented by the ERS - Energy Recovery System - with a maximum power of 200 kW (272 Hp),


    The new Ferrari 499P, whose lines were finalized with the involvement of the Ferrari Style Center, under the direction of Flavio Manzoni, enhances the car's technical and aerodynamics, through simple and sinuous shapes, an explicit expression of the Ferrari DNA.

Made from a carbon fiber monocoque frame, under the "dress" the Ferrari 499P is characterized by solutions that represent the avant-garde in the field of technologies applied to motorsport.

The geometry of the suspension, with overlapping triangles of the "push-rod" type, makes it possible to achieve qualities of stiffness that translate into outstanding performance, which is evident both at the highest absolute speeds and when traveling through curves.

No less sophisticated is the braking system, which integrates a brake-by-wire system necessary to allow the recovery of the kinetic energy during braking by the electric front axle and developed to combine precision and speed of response with reliability and durability. complementary aspects whose synthesis is one of the keys to success of endurance races.


    The debut of the 499P in the Fia World Endurance Championship will be on March 17, 2023 at Sebring in the United States.
